First edition, first impression. 106pp with occasional illustrations. In blue cloth boards with gilt lettering on spine. Coloured endpapers. 8vo. Crisp, fresh and bright throughout. In its original illustrated dust wrapper, very slightly bumped at spine head. Dust jacket now in a protective Mylar wrapper fitted without the use of tape or glue.
Drawn from the darker side of Tolkien's imagination and set during the age of chivalry in Britain's land beyond the seas, this is the tale of a childless Breton Lord and his Lady when tradegy follows when the accept the help of Aotrou and a magical potion from a malevolent fairy.
